Detonation is a short term worry. Washing your cylinders with fuel due to rich mixture off boost, and scarring bores, is a long term one.

If it runs lean, as you say it does, you are doing one of three things: detonating, high freq detonating (inaudible), or running so lean the AF isn't igniting.

10 psi on a high mileage ZC, running pig rich 10.5:1 AFR and conservative 1 deg/psi retard, is enough to pull stock LS1 Z28/SS/WS6 on the highway in a heavy 91 Civic Si w/ speaker box + such. Go find one of the ubiquitous F-bodies and see how you fare, I guarantee it doesn't work out the way it should, Stock injectors, at 55 psig base pressure, won't support the power level.
